We will be working in partnership with TGP Cymru andCardiff and Vale Health Inclusion Service and together we hope to empower young people and bring impactful change to systems involving the mental health and well-being of asylum seekers and refugees. Oasis Cardiff will lead this project, and together the partnership will pool our resources, skills and experience working in the sector.

The key to this project is co-production and ensuring young people are at the heart of the decision-making process. By facilitating a young person-led steering group, and advocacy groups, the project's critical aim is to engage young people to find solutions and make their voices heard.

      

This project will focus on building resilience in young people and providing opportunities for community and personal growth. Young people need to be given a platform to openly express their concerns and issues easily. Our hope is that this would lead to increased emotional resilience in young people, as they pursue avenues of specialist support and are given access to increased opportunities, which would benefit their well-being.

The project will have a mental health worker who will enable young people to access to psychoeducation as part of this project and the aim is that young people will be empowered to influence policy and systems in partner Statutory Sector Organisations.
